PHP features and specs

  • Cost-Effective
    PHP is an open-source language, meaning it is free to use. This helps reduce the overall cost of a project.
  • Large Community
    PHP has a large and active community. This means vast amounts of documentation, tutorials, and third-party resources are available.
  • Cross-Platform
    PHP is platform-independent and can run on various operating systems like Windows, Linux, and macOS.
  • Database Support
    PHP supports a wide range of databases including MySQL, PostgreSQL, SQLite, and more.
  • Speed
    PHP is generally fast, especially when used with built-in tools and extensions. It integrates easily with web servers like Apache.
  • Built-in Functions
    PHP comes with a vast range of built-in functions and libraries, which makes developing common functionalities easier and faster.
  • Server-Side Scripting
    PHP is designed specifically for server-side scripting, making it well-suited for web development.

Possible disadvantages of PHP

  • Security
    If not properly managed, PHP applications can be vulnerable to security threats like SQL injection, XSS, and others.
  • Inconsistency
    PHP's function naming and parameter ordering can be inconsistent, which can make the language difficult to learn and use efficiently.
  • Performance
    While fast for many tasks, PHP can struggle with performance for high-resource applications compared to other languages like Node.js or Python.
  • Error Handling
    Error handling in PHP is less efficient and more cumbersome compared to modern languages like Python or JavaScript.
  • Concurrency
    PHP lacks native support for multi-threading, which can be a limitation for applications requiring high concurrency.
  • Old Codebases
    Many older PHP applications use outdated coding practices, making maintaining and updating them more difficult and costly.
  • Type System
    PHP historically had a weak typing system, though recent versions have introduced better type support, it's still a drawback for older codebases.

CryptoKitties features and specs

  • Innovative Blockchain Use
    CryptoKitties introduced many to the concept of Non-Fungible Tokens (NFTs), showcasing how blockchain technology can be used beyond cryptocurrencies by creating unique digital assets.
  • Ownership and Scarcity
    Each CryptoKitty is unique and owned by the player, providing a digital collectible that cannot be replicated, offering true digital ownership and scarcity.
  • Play-to-Earn Mechanics
    Players can potentially earn money by breeding and trading CryptoKitties, as some rare kitties can be sold for significant amounts of money.
  • Educational Value
    The game serves as an educational tool for blockchain technology, helping users to understand and appreciate the concept of decentralized applications and smart contracts.
  • Vibrant Community
    CryptoKitties has a large and engaged community, which creates a lively market and social environment for players to interact and trade.

Possible disadvantages of CryptoKitties

  • High Gas Fees
    Because CryptoKitties is built on the Ethereum blockchain, users often face high gas fees, especially during times of network congestion, which can make transactions expensive.
  • Market Volatility
    The value of CryptoKitties is subject to extreme market fluctuations, making it a risky investment as prices for digital kitties can vary widely over short periods.
  • Speculative Nature
    The game's emphasis on trading and breeding for profit can lead to a speculative environment, where the focus shifts from enjoyment to financial gain.
  • Environmental Concerns
    The reliance on Ethereum means that CryptoKitties contribute to the environmental impact associated with high energy consumption of Proof-of-Work blockchains.
  • Complexity for New Users
    New users may find the process of buying, trading, and understanding the genetic algorithms of CryptoKitties complex, which can be a barrier to entry.

Analysis of CryptoKitties

Overall verdict

  • CryptoKitties is generally considered a good introduction to the concept of NFTs and blockchain gaming. It was groundbreaking when first released and continues to offer an engaging experience for those interested in the mechanics of digital scarcity and collectibility. However, like many blockchain projects, it remains niche and may not appeal to everyone, especially those uninterested in digital collectibles or unfamiliar with cryptocurrency concepts.

Why this product is good

  • CryptoKitties is one of the pioneering blockchain-based games that introduced the concept of non-fungible tokens (NFTs) to a broad audience. It allows users to buy, breed, and sell virtual cats, each with unique attributes. This game showcases the potential of blockchain technology in creating and managing digital assets, providing entertainment while also offering players a chance to engage in a digital economy. It has garnered a community of collectors and enthusiasts interested in digital collectibles and blockchain applications.
